Description
Unveil the mesmerizing lore of Destrehan Plantation! Prepare to be enraptured by the exquisite 1787 plantation house, as you venture inside to discover the haunting tales of plantation life. Wander through the slave quarters, where an eye-opening understanding of the past awaits you. Behold the very fields and machinery that powered the economy, fueled by the extraordinary sugar cane. Your heart will soar as you witness the remarkable documents signed by none other than Thomas Jefferson and James Madison. Immerse yourself in the extraordinary narratives of the enslaved men and women, who breathed life into this thriving plantation. With an enthralling guided tour, captivating folk-life demonstrations, and the chance to explore the resplendent grounds, this is an absolute must-see for all history buffs and fervent culture enthusiasts!
